Job Summary
The Visual Content Specialist is responsible for developing, producing, and editing high-quality multimedia content that brings Nextech’s brand, products, and customer stories to life. This role creates a wide range of video assets, including, but not limited to, customer testimonials, product demos, event footage, launch videos, sizzle reels, and internal/executive content. They ensure all visuals align with Nextech’s strategic priorities and brand identity.
The Visual Content Specialist will collaborate closely with Corporate Communications, Product, Design, and Marketing teams to transform complex healthcare topics into engaging, modern, and accessible visual stories. This role also supports on-site filming at key events (annual user conference, national sales meeting, trade shows) and may assist with podcast recording and production.

Essential Functions
- Produce, shoot, and edit multimedia content including customer videos, product demos, testimonials, executive interviews, marketing campaign assets, and more
- Plan and execute video projects from concept to completion, in collaboration with marketing team, including scripting, storyboarding, filming, editing, sound, and delivery.
- Capture on-site videos at events.
- Develop creative approaches to simplify and visualize complex healthcare and technology concepts in engaging, on-brand ways.
- Create compelling sizzle reels, highlight videos, and promotional content to support product launches, marketing campaigns, and internal initiatives.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with Product, Brand, and Demand Generation on video strategy and execution.
- Ensure video content adheres to Nextech brand guidelines and maintains a consistent visual identity.
- Properly manage and maintain equipment: camera, lighting, sound, support accessories, computer/laptop, external hard drives, etc.
- Meticulous file organization: properly save and back up all working/editable files, purchased footage/sound files, and final deliverables in team-accessible location.
- Provide creative direction and proactively recommend new formats, storytelling opportunities, and visual approaches.
- Support podcast production, including recording, audio cleanup, editing, and promotional video cuts

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ene
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.
Key Facts About Boston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
-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
